Technical Field
The utility model relates to the field of medical auxiliary equipment, especially, relate to a bite-block that can connect suction device.
Background
Serious patients in neurology department are critically ill due to illness, and after tracheotomy, the patients often follow the involuntary movement of the mouth, the long-time chewing of the mouth can cause the increase of oral saliva secretion, the untimely sucking can cause the oro-underwater pharynx and cause the discomfort of the throat of the patients to choke, the risk of aspiration can be caused, and the risk of lung infection of the patients is increased; the lip injury or tongue bite injury of a patient can be caused by long-time involuntary movement and frequent chewing of the oral cavity of the patient. At present, what the clearance patient oral cavity saliva adopted is to stretch into the patient oral cavity with the oral cavity skin direct contact absorb with inhaling the phlegm pipe, however frequent phlegm pipe of inhaling attracts can increase the stimulation to patient's oral cavity, and frequent stimulation and attraction can lead to inhaling the damage of phlegm pipe to the oral mucosa.
The Chinese utility model patent with the patent name of bite block, patent number ZL201520862847.0, publication date 2016-03-23, which comprises a main body and a pair of side ears, wherein the main body is composed of a hollow solid part, the side ears are arranged on the solid part, and the hollow part is provided with an opening for communicating the inner wall and the outer wall of the hollow part. According to the technical scheme, the hollow part extends into the mouth of a patient, saliva secreted by the mouth of the patient flows into the tooth pad through the opening, and the trachea cannula is assisted to be fixed through the lateral ear. However, such bite-block is fixed not to be trampled really, can not avoid the patient frequently to chew and lead to the bite-block to drop, can not protect patient's oral cavity position betterly to because bite-block and inhale the phlegm pipe and be the components of a whole that can function independently structure, inhale the phlegm pipe and insert in the bite-block and do not fix betterly, make to inhale the phlegm pipe and drop easily and lead to the operation inconvenient.

Referring to fig. 1, the utility model provides a bite-block capable of connecting with suction device, which comprises a bite-block main body 1 with an inner cavity, wherein a drainage port 11 and a tooth socket 12 are arranged on the far-end side wall of the bite-block main body 1 for extending into the oral cavity of a patient, a fixing band 13 is arranged on the near-end side wall of the bite-block main body 1, a sputum suction tube interface 14 is arranged on the near-end of the bite-block main body 1, and a sputum suction tube 2 capable of being connected with an external negative pressure suction device is arranged on the sputum suction tube interface 14 to form a sputum suction channel from the drainage port 11, the inner cavity of the bite-block main body 1, the sputum suction tube interface 14 to the sputum suction tube 2 in; the sputum suction tube 2 is arranged in the sputum suction tube interface 14, so that the sputum suction tube 2 is prevented from falling off accidentally; the alveolus 12 can be made of silicon rubber materials which are harmless to the human body, when a patient without incisors uses the alveolus 12 directly contacts with the gingiva of the patient, the alveolus 12 materials made of the silicon rubber materials are softer, the patient is prevented from excessively occluding to cause lip and gum damage and prevent the patient from excessively occluding to the upper incisors and the lower incisors.
In the utility model, a thin tube 21 is arranged in the inner cavity of the bite block main body 1, and the upper end of the thin tube 21 is arranged on the sputum suction tube interface 14, wherein, the inner cavity is communicated with the sputum suction tube 2 through the thin tube 21, and at least one sputum suction port 211 is arranged at the lower end of the thin tube 21; can be the saliva suction in the bite-block main part 1 through inhaling phlegm mouth 211 on tubule 21 to, the length of tubule 21 at the internal chamber of bite-block main part 1 is shorter than bite-block main part 1, and tubule 21 does not stretch out outside bite-block main part 1 promptly, therefore tubule 21 does not contact with patient's oral cavity, thereby frequently stimulates patient's oral cavity when avoiding tubule 21 to attract the saliva in patient's oral cavity, prevents to cause the damage to patient's oral mucosa.
In the utility model, the sputum suction tube 2 is also provided with a negative pressure control port 22, when the negative pressure suction needs to be continuously carried out, the sputum suction tube 2 is connected with an external negative pressure suction apparatus and the negative pressure control port 22 is closed, and the thin tube 21 sucks saliva of a patient; if the negative pressure suction is not needed, the connection between the sputum suction tube 2 and the external negative pressure suction apparatus is disconnected or the negative pressure control port 22 is opened, and the narrow tube 21 stops sucking saliva in the oral cavity of the patient.
In the utility model, the tooth socket 12 is a flat cylindrical structure, the cross-sectional area of the tooth socket 12 is smaller than that of the tooth pad main body 1, and the tooth pad main body 1 is in an elliptic cylindrical shape; the human oral cavity position of alveolus 12 and the shape laminating of bite-block main part 1 can effectively fix patient's tooth portion or gum position to can prevent that bite-block main part 1 from producing great displacement, avoid bite-block main part 1 frequently amazing patient's oral cavity inner wall.
In the utility model, two fixing bands 13 are arranged on the fixing band 13 and two fixing bands 13 are symmetrically arranged on the side wall of the near end of the bite block main body 1, wherein, one fixing band 13 is provided with a reinforcing block 131, and the reinforcing block 131 can increase the stability of the fixing band 13, so that the fixing band 13 is not easy to break; the end of two fixed bands 13 can adopt the magic subsides structure of mutually supporting, and the medical personnel of being convenient for fix bite-block main part 1.
When the utility model is used, the bite block main body 1 is placed in the oral cavity of a patient, the tooth part of the patient is guided to contact with the tooth socket 12, the fixing belt 13 is adjusted according to the face shape of the patient, thereby the bite block main body 1 is fixed at the oral cavity part of the patient, and when the suction is needed to be continuously performed, the sputum suction pipe 2 is connected with an external negative pressure suction apparatus and the negative pressure control port 22 is closed; when continuous suction is needed to be suspended, the connection between the sputum suction tube 2 and the external negative pressure suction apparatus is disconnected or the negative pressure control port 22 is opened.
